Summary:
This groundbreaking collection of essays contains unique studies of the regional differences among countries in the English, French, Dutch and Spanish Caribbean, and each one explores the distinct political cultures of these nations. The contributors, renowned internationally for their expertise in Caribbean studies, approach the topic from their varied cultural experiences and offer a new dimension to the study of the region's complex political culture.
